Important support received: 800,000 euros for two leisure pools

Jenaer Bäder und Freizeit GmbH and SAALEMAXX Freizeit- und Erlebnisbad Rudolstadt GmbH received a welcome grant from the state of Thuringia last week. Katharina Schenk, State Secretary of the Thuringian Ministry of the Interior and Local Government, presented a grant of around 300,000 euros for SAALEMAXX in Rudolstadt and around 500,000 euros for the GalaxSea leisure pool in Jena.

As a result of the drastic rise in energy costs, both pools had applied for financial support. The funding is provided as part of a livelihood support program for municipal companies, which aims to support institutions in overcoming economic challenges.

For the two pools, the grants represent an important contribution to securing the operation of the pools and maintaining the diverse, high-quality offerings for visitors. The funding clearly shows that the state government recognizes the importance of these leisure and health facilities for the respective cities and actively supports their continued existence.
